Output 106bffd352691ea1ee5468163c59e94ebacd57c40c309109b5972c094e54c670:0

value
531000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93e46fae07c06d44175da80b11813895b89e6454 OP_EQUALVERIFY OP_CHECKSIG
address
LYhwFSXZrSoeaMYj9P6rtzPStneevJGe7i
transaction
106bffd352691ea1ee5468163c59e94ebacd57c40c309109b5972c094e54c670
spent
true